Understanding the Role of an Auto Car Locksmith
An auto car locksmith focuses on offering services connected to car locks and keys. These specialists can assist with a variety of problems, including:
- Key Duplication: Making specific copies of your car keys, consisting of high-security and transponder keys.
- Lockout Assistance: Unlocking your vehicle when you've been locked out.
- Key Programming: Programming new keys for modern-day lorries with electronic key systems.
- Lock Replacement: Replacing damaged or damaged locks.
- Key Fob Repair and Replacement: Fixing or changing broken key fobs and remote entry gadgets.
- Ignition Repair: Addressing issues with your car's ignition system.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much does it cost to get a car opened?A: The cost to open a car can differ depending on the locksmith, the type of lock, and the time of day. Usually, you can expect to pay between ₤ 30 and ₤ 100. Emergency services might cost more.
Q: Can I get a new key for my car if I've lost the original?A: Yes, a professional auto car locksmith can produce a new key for your car. They may require the vehicle's V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) and may need evidence of ownership to ensure the process is legal.
Q: Do I require a professional to program a new car key?A: Yes, most modern cars and trucks need professional programming for brand-new keys. This procedure includes syncing the key with the car's internal computer system, which can be complicated and needs specific equipment.
Q: Is it legal to have an auto car locksmith make a copy of my key without the initial?A: It depends upon the laws in your area. In numerous places, a locksmith can make a copy of a car key without the initial if you offer evidence of ownership and the vehicle's VIN. However, it's always best to check local guidelines.
Q: Can an auto car locksmith aid with a broken key in the ignition?A: Yes, a professional auto car locksmith can extract a broken key from the ignition and create a brand-new one if essential. They will use specific tools to ensure the procedure is done safely and without damaging the ignition.
Q: How long does it consider an auto car locksmith to show up?A: The action time can differ depending on the locksmith and the location of the service call. Lots of expert locksmiths aim to show up within 30 minutes to an hour, specifically for emergency services.
